cabas Definition
a woman's bag, typically made of straw or wickerwork.

Summary: cabas in Brief
'Cabas' [kaˈba] is a type of woman's bag, usually made of straw or wickerwork. It is commonly used for carrying items to the beach or market, as in 'She carried a cabas to the beach.' The term extends to specific types like 'cabas de voyage,' a travel bag, and 'cabas à provisions,' a shopping bag.
